Step 1
Preheat oven at 450°F.
Step 2
In a large bowl, combine gluten-free flour, oat flour, and salt, and mix.
Step 3
Add in the water gradually and keep mixing.
Step 4
Once you have mixed everything, knead the dough and shape it into a ball.
Step 5
Then, flatten it out on a counter.
Step 6
Roll the dough until you acquire a cracker-like thickness.
Step 7
Ensure you roll it out equally from all sides.
Step 8
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Step 9
Place the rolled-out dough on it.
Step 10
Cut it into desired size and shape.
Step 11
Lightly prick the top with a fork.
Step 12
Spray the crackers with olive oil.
Step 13
Next, place the baking sheet with the crackers in the oven.
Step 14
Bake the crackers for about 10 minutes or until you see a light-brown color.
Step 15
Serve and enjoy!
